Aussies finish second in Argentina

Courtesy: Argentina Golf Association Netherlands team Dani l Huizing and Robin Kind maintained their advantage and won the 40th edition of the Juan Carlos Tailhade Cup in Los Lagartos Country Club, in Argentina. Australia (Todd Sinnott and Nathan Holman) was second – 2 strokes behind. The fight for the title was exciting during Sunday. The Australians and Dutch were fighting stroke for stroke. Only at the end of the fourth round changed history for Holland. Huizing made a great birdie at the 18th hole while Holman could only manage a double bogey. We are so happy. I knew I had holed at the final hole and I made it , said Huizing, who finished first with 275 strokes also in the individual competition With this victory, the Netherlands are three time winners of this great amateur event, one of the most important in the world.
